Albo Verte tomatoes are a distinctive heirloom variety known for their unique color and rich flavor. Here are the details:
Characteristics:
- Appearance: Medium to large, round fruits with pale green skin that has a slight yellowish tint when ripe. The skin is smooth, and the flesh is also light green with a subtle marbling.
- Flavor: Mildly sweet with a hint of tartness, offering a complex and well-balanced taste, making them a favorite for those who prefer low-acid tomatoes.
- Texture: Firm, juicy flesh with a smooth texture, making them perfect for slicing and fresh eating.
- Growth: Indeterminate plants that produce a steady yield of fruit throughout the growing season.
Growing Tips:
- Soil: Prefers rich, well-draining, loamy soil with added organic matter.
- Sunlight: Requires full sun for optimal flavor development.
- Watering: Consistent watering is essential, but ensure the soil doesn’t become waterlogged.
- Support: Best grown with stakes or cages to support the plant’s growth and heavy fruit production.
Culinary Uses:
- Great for fresh salads, sandwiches, or slicing for topping dishes.
- Ideal for making mild salsas, chutneys, or sauces.
- Can be roasted, grilled, or eaten raw for a refreshing, mild flavor.
